Internal memo — Recalled charger pallet

To the office manager: the pallet of recalled VoltPrim chargers from the Ashgrove branch is staged in Bay 3, shrink-wrapped and tagged with red recall stickers. Do not release any units for reuse or disposal; the supplier, Corvane Electrics, requires the full count returned intact. The return manifest is attached to the pallet sleeve and must travel with the load. A courier from Corvane is scheduled this week, and the confidential hand-over instruction appears below.

handover note for yagef-bagep: the drudor pelius courier leaves the kasdor zorvan norir ledger at gate 8016 under passcode 755406

☐ Verify the tax-rate lookup cache in the Ledgerline billing service is invalidated within 24 hours of any jurisdiction table update. Confirm the TTL setting matches the documented value, check that stale-read alerts fired correctly during the last quarter, and record any manual flushes with justification. Future maintainers should note that discrepancies here can cause mispriced invoices; all findings must be reviewed by the accountable owner named below.

named custodian: Brivan Eliath Quenox Frador

TICKET #— Vault lockout blocking SDK parity check

The Pinwheel credential vault locked after repeated token refresh failures. We need it open to run the parity suite comparing the Marlin and Osprey client SDKs — Osprey is missing batch uploads and retry hints, and the matrix job pulls fixtures from that vault. New folks: don't retry logins, it extends the lockout. Unseal manually with the recovery passphrase below.

vault phrase of tawef-bajep = zormir-druox-silael-pelax-druiel-ralion-oliox

Subject: Handover — export retry queue

Taking over from me as of Friday. Failed exports land in the retry queue on Dunmore; worker retries three times with backoff, then parks them. Check the parked set each morning. Audit trail is intact — every retry is logged with actor and timestamp, which should satisfy your review. Do not requeue manually without a ticket. Redeploying the retry worker requires the release signing key, which I'm leaving for you directly below this note.

deploy key for kajof-fajop: bky6_gDHw9Q